      Meaning of the first name
      Baba

      Origin 
      African

      Meaning 
      Born on Thursday

      Variations 
      Babak, Babar, Baback

      The name Baba has its origins in Africa and is derived from the local languages and cultures of the region. In these cultures, names often carry significant meaning, reflecting important aspects of an individual's identity, such as birth order, family lineage, or even the day of the week they were born. Baba specifically translates to Born on Thursday, highlighting the significance of the day of the week as a naming convention in some African societies. This name exemplifies the practice of bestowing names based on the day a child enters the world, symbolizing a connection to the celestial cycles and the cultural importance of certain days.

      In history, the name Baba has been used to identify individuals within African communities, emphasizing their birth on a Thursday and referencing the cultural context from which they originate. This cultural naming practice continues to be prevalent in many African countries today, where individuals are still given names that reflect their birth order or the day they were born. In modern-day usage, the name Baba can be found in African communities across the world as a testament to the cultural heritage and the significance placed on individual identities, embodying the rich traditions and beliefs that continue to shape the African people and their descendants. Whether used as a given name or a nickname, Baba represents the enduring connection to a profound African heritage.
